TEMPE, Ariz. - The Northern Arizona University track and field program heads to Tempe, Ariz. for Arizona State University's 39th annual Sun Angel Classic Friday and Saturday at Sun Angel Stadium.
It is the fourth meet of the outdoor season for the Lumberjacks who are fresh off solid performances at two national caliber meets at Stanford University and the University of Texas, March 29-31. The sprints, distances, and jump groups competed at the Stanford Invitational while the throwing unit was at the Texas Relays.
It is also the second time fans will get the chance to make the short drive to Tempe after the team competed at the Baldy Castillo Invitational back on March 16-17.
"We're excited to get another shot to come down to compete at Arizona State," director of track and field Michael Smith said. "We have been working through our process and while I have been very happy with the results up to this point, our athletes know we have some more work to do still before the Big Sky Championships and regionals. We are looking for this meet to be another positive step towards our outdoor season goals."
The field at ASU will be one of the best the Lumberjacks will see during the outdoor regular season as the meet will play host to nine ranked programs including a top five women's program (No. 4 USC) and two of the top six men's programs (No. 5 USC and No. 6 Texas Tech).
